[TOP]

精通嵌入式Linux程式設: 駕馭Linux系統 隨心所欲創造出靈活又穩健的嵌入式裝置 = Mastering embedded Linux programming

此書被瀏覽0次

0人閱讀過此書

副標題 :

作者 : Chris Simmonds,錢亞宏

分類 : Computer Studies 電腦

關鍵字 : 作業系統

Yocto Project開發者兼Linux Foundation成員~~Richard Purdie推薦

駕馭Linux系統
隨心所欲創造出靈活又穩健的嵌入式裝置

本書的內容將帶領你遍覽開發週期的每個環節,並深入環節中的每個階段,說明階段中的元件以及可利用的工具。本書將一路從工具鏈、啟動載入器、Linux內核,再到如何設置一個根目錄檔案系統,以及學習使用Buildroot與Yocto Project這兩款在開發社群中最常見的組建系統,加速並簡化你的開發流程。在此基礎之上,我們將一同探討如何妥善運用NAND/NOR以及管理型eMMC的快閃記憶體特性,以便延長裝置的使用生命與建立可靠的線上更新機制。接著,會討論執行緒的使用情境,這些議題將大大影響成品的效能與回應能力。最後,我們將一同學習perf與ftrace的使用方式,了解對應用程式與內核進行剖析和追蹤的方法。

【適用讀者】
本書的內容適合那些在嵌入式系統領域上已經有所發展的Linux開發者與系統工程師,幫助他們進一步建立出最佳化的裝置。閱讀本書之前,需要具備基礎的C程式語言開發能力,以及對系統程式設計的相關經驗。

【你能夠從本書學習到】
◎ 了解Linux內核所扮演的角色,對應用程式的定位有所認知。
◎ 利用Buildroot與Yocto Project,快速有效率地建立出嵌入式Linux系統。
◎ 使用U-Boot創造出客製化的啟動載入器。
◎ 透過perf與ftrace來找出效能上的瓶頸。
◎ 熟悉硬體結構樹的使用,替設備添加新的硬體裝置。
◎ 開發出可與Linux裝置驅動程式互動的應用程式。
◎ 利用POSIX標準,設計多執行緒的應用程式。
◎ 在即時系統中進行量測,修改Linux內核降低延遲。
0則評論
 
 

精通嵌入式Linux程式設: 駕馭Linux系統 隨心所欲創造出靈活又穩健的嵌入式裝置 = Mastering embedded Linux programming

ACNO C21726
索書號 312.54 9488
複本總數 1
館藏位置 中文書架 Chinese
借閱分類 Book
ISBN 9789864342990
出版商 博碩文化
出版年份 2018
版本 初版
警告 No Alert Message
小說 N
語言 中文
科目 Computer Studies 電腦
購買日期 2019-04-13
價格 173.6
面(頁)數 24, 392 p.
插圖及稽核細節 ill.
未選擇任何檔案 選擇檔案
支援上載大小: 10mb | 檔案類型
標題:  Youtube: 

最新書評

更多

閱讀進度

已加入書櫃的書,可在此處記錄你的閱讀進度啊!

己看完此書了嗎?快快寫下你的感想及評分吧!

本書籍資訊

ACNO C21726
索書號 312.54 9488
館藏位置 中文書架 Chinese
借閱分類 Book
ISBN 9789864342990
出版商 博碩文化
出版年份 2018
版本 初版

關鍵字 (1)

作者 Chris Simmonds 相關作品

    複本